How to conjugate fluctuar in Indicative Preterite in Spanish

fluctuar
to fluctuate
regular verb

Fluctuar means to vary or change irregularly, often used to describe prices, temperatures, or other quantities that go up and down.

How to conjugate fluctuar in Indicative Preterite

El Pretérito Indefinido - used to talk about actions completed in the past, at a specific point in time

Indicative Preterite Conjugations

PronounConjugation
Yo
fluctué
fluctuaste
Él / Ella / Usted
fluctuó
Nosotros / Nosotras
fluctuamos
Vosotros / Vosotras
fluctuasteis
Ellos / Ellas / Ustedes
fluctuaron
